Malleable Iron 90 Degree Elbow An Overview of Its Manufacturing and Applications
Malleable iron has established itself as a preferred material in various industries due to its excellent mechanical properties and versatility. One of the most commonly used fittings in piping systems is the 90-degree elbow made from malleable iron. In this article, we will explore the characteristics, manufacturing process, and applications of malleable iron 90-degree elbows.
Characteristics of Malleable Iron
Malleable iron is a type of cast iron that has been heat-treated to improve its ductility and toughness. Unlike brittle cast iron, malleable iron can deform without breaking, making it suitable for high-stress applications. The material's strength and corrosion resistance further enhance its utility, especially in environments exposed to moisture and chemicals. Malleable iron elbows are particularly favored for their ability to withstand high pressure and are less prone to cracking.
The Manufacturing Process
The production of malleable iron 90-degree elbows involves several steps
1. Molten Iron Production The process begins with the melting of iron, usually combined with other elements like carbon to produce the desired alloy.
2. Casting The molten iron is then poured into molds and allowed to cool. Initial casting produces a hard, brittle form known as white iron.
3. Heat Treatment To convert white iron into malleable iron, the cast pieces undergo a heat treatment process. This involves heating the cast iron to a specific temperature and holding it for a predetermined time, followed by slow cooling. This process transforms the structure of the iron, imparting the ductile properties characteristic of malleable iron.
5. Quality Control Finally, the elbows are inspected for defects and tested for strength and durability. This ensures that they meet industry standards before being shipped to customers.
Applications in Various Industries
Malleable iron 90-degree elbows are widely used in a plethora of industries. Their primary application is within plumbing and piping systems, where they facilitate changes in direction. These fittings are vital in residential plumbing, commercial buildings, and industrial applications.
In addition to plumbing, these elbows serve crucial roles in
- Oil and Gas Malleable iron elbows can be found in pipelines that transport oil and natural gas, where durability and resistance to stress and corrosion are paramount.
- Heating and Cooling Systems In HVAC systems, these elbows help reroute ducts and piping efficiently, ensuring optimal airflow and temperature regulation.
- Fire Protection Systems They are utilized in the installation of fire sprinkler systems, providing reliable connections that prevent leaks during emergencies.
